摘要:通过10种6-BA浓度的增殖培养及分别的壮苗、生根培养,考察了6-BA动态变化对桉树组培出苗的影响,结果表明:增殖培养在6-BA 0.5 ~ 2.0 mg·L-1浓度下保持2.5 ~ 3.3倍的增殖率,而在2.5 ~ 5.0 mg·L-1浓度范围时第1个培养周期具有较高的增殖率(2.7 ~ 3.0倍),连续2 ~ 3个周期培养,增殖率下降到1.22 ~ 1.67,接近甚至低于不加6-BA的培养基.2.5 ~ 5.0 mg·L-1的6-BA浓度水平对其后1代的壮苗和生根培养产生不利的影响,第2次壮苗和生根继代时影响消除.
Dynamic effect of 6-BA on Eucalyptus tissue culture seedling yield was carried out by proliferation culture with 10 different concentrations of 6-BA and special culture of strong seedling and rooting. The result showed that proliferation rate could keep 2.5 ~ 3.3 times per culture when the concentration of 6-BA was between 0.5 ~ 2.0 mgˇL-1. When the concentration of 6-BA was 2.5 ~ 5.0 mgˇL-1, the proliferation rate reached as high as 2.7 ~ 3.0 times in the first culture, but with only two or three proliferation subcultures it declined to that as without 6-BA. High 6-BA concentration in proliferation culture had negative effect on elongation and rooting, but it could be counteracted by more elongation subcu- ltures.
